I have Brownings and Stealth Cams. Neither is bad, but I prefer the Stealth Cams. The batteries have lasted significantly longer, picture quality is about the same between the two models I have, but the Stealth cam was about $30 cheaper. I also feel like the cards are easier to take out on the Stealth Cams. Just my $0.02.
